Description
Burrata Bruschetta is a simple yet elegant appetizer featuring creamy burrata cheese on toasted bread, topped with fresh tomatoes, basil, and a drizzle of balsamic glaze.
Ingredients

- 1 baguette, sliced into 1/2-inch pieces
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 2 cloves garlic, peeled
- 1 1/2 cups cherry tomatoes, halved
- 8 oz burrata cheese
- 1/4 cup fresh basil leaves, chopped
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Balsamic glaze for drizzling
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Brush baguette slices with olive oil and place on a baking sheet.
- Toast in the oven for 8-10 minutes until golden and crispy.
- Rub each toasted slice with a garlic clove for added flavor.
- Top each slice with a spoonful of burrata cheese.
- Add halved cherry tomatoes and sprinkle with chopped basil.
- Season with salt and pepper.
- Drizzle with balsamic glaze just before serving.
Notes
- Use heirloom tomatoes for extra color and flavor.
- Burrata should be at room temperature for best texture.
- Can be made ahead and assembled just before serving.
